Have you been subject to police brutality in Utah?



The Utah state Highway Patrol has cleared a officer for shocking a man twice (once while laying on the ground in oncoming traffic) because he wouldn’t sign a traffic ticket without knowing how fast he was going. Utah feels this type of brutality is justified. Have you been subject to similar types of mistreatment and do you feel the state responded properly to your complaints?
